Latest Patents

One of Dean's significant patents is the "Board-supporting assembly for fluid jet cutting system." This invention describes a platen assembly designed to support a master board of material during the cutting process. The assembly features a layer of resiliently compressible material that is bonded to a lattice-like network of relatively uncuttable structural material. This design allows the compressible material to act as a cushion while anchoring the master board against movement. Additionally, the lattice-like network prevents the compressible material on either side of a cut from migrating towards the cut, ensuring precision and stability during operation.
